Get notified when packages are built

A new feature has been added. FreshPorts already tracks package built by the FreeBSD project. This information is displayed on each port page. You can now get an email when FreshPorts notices a new package is available for something on one of your watch lists. However, you must opt into that. Click on Report Subscriptions on the right, and New Package Notification box, and click on Update.

Finally, under Watch Lists, click on ABI Package Subscriptions to select your ABI (e.g. FreeBSD:14:amd64) & package set (latest/quarterly) combination for a given watch list. This is what FreshPorts will look for.

Description:
pyjson5 is a Python implementation of the JSON5 data format. JSON5 extends the JSON data interchange format to make it slightly more usable as a configuration language: - JavaScript-style comments (both single and multi-line) are legal. - Object keys may be unquoted if they are legal ECMAScript identifiers - Objects and arrays may end with trailing commas. - Strings can be single-quoted, and multi-line string literals are allowed. This project implements a reader and writer implementation for Python; where possible, it mirrors the standard Python JSON API package for ease of use. There is one notable difference from the JSON api: the load() and loads() methods support optionally checking for (and rejecting) duplicate object keys; pass allow_duplicate_keys=False to do so (duplicates are allowed by default).
